Web29 jan. 2024 · In most cases, using a 50/50 solution of white distilled vinegar and water will remove water spots. Simply mix it up in an empty spray bottle, spray it on your windows, let it sit for a few minutes, and wipe away. If one application doesn’t work, do it again. Web19 apr. 2024 · To remove moisture from your car follow these steps: 1. Turn on the air conditioning and direct the vents towards the windows. 2. Park in the sun to help speed up the dehumidifying process. 3. Place a dehumidifier in the car to absorb the moisture from the air. 4.
